Abstract
A defibrillation training system (10) is disclosed for use in training individuals in the proper positioning of defibrillation electrodes on a patient. The system includes a pair of training electrodes (12), each of which includes a permanent magnet (40). The training electrodes are attached to a manikin (14) at two electrode placement sites (42 and 44) provided with arrays (46 and 48) of Hall-effect sensors. The magnetic field produced by the permanent magnet in each electrode is sensed by the corresponding array, allowing an electrode placement monitor (16), attached to the manikin, to determine the electrodes' positions. The placement monitor then determines whether any adjustments in the electrodes' positions are required and prompts the individual being trained accordingly.
